ODS fájlok HTML-lé konvertálása a GroupDocs.Conversion for .NET használatával

Bevezetés

A mai digitális környezetben a vállalkozásoknak gyakran kell online megosztaniuk és közzétenniük táblázatadatokat. Akár egy irányítópult-alkalmazáson dolgozó fejlesztő, akár egy jelentéseket készítő rendszergazda, az ODS-fájlok HTML-re konvertálása leegyszerűsítheti a munkafolyamatot. Ez az oktatóanyag bemutatja, hogyan használható GroupDocs.Conversion .NET-hez hogy könnyedén konvertáljon Open Document Spreadsheet (.ods) fájlokat Hyper Text Markup Language (.html) formátumba. Az útmutató végére megtanulja, hogyan javíthatja az adatok hozzáférhetőségét és megjelenítését a táblázatok webbarát formátumokba konvertálásával.

Amit tanulni fogsz:

  • Környezet beállítása a GroupDocs.Conversion for .NET segítségével
  • Lépésről lépésre útmutató az ODS fájlok HTML formátumba konvertálásához
  • konverzió során a teljesítmény optimalizálásának legjobb gyakorlatai
  • A konverziós folyamat gyakorlati alkalmazásai

Nézzük át, milyen előfeltételekre van szükséged, mielőtt belekezdenénk.

Előfeltételek

Mielőtt elkezdenénk, győződjünk meg arról, hogy a következőkkel rendelkezünk:

Szükséges könyvtárak és verziók:

  • GroupDocs.Conversion .NET-hez 25.3.0 verzió

Környezeti beállítási követelmények:

  • .NET Framework vagy .NET Core telepítve a gépeden
  • Visual Studio (bármely újabb verzió) a kód fejlesztéséhez és teszteléséhez

Előfeltételek a tudáshoz:

  • C# programozás alapjainak ismerete
  • Jártasság a .NET alkalmazások fájlkezelésében

Miután az előfeltételekkel tisztában vagyunk, térjünk át a GroupDocs.Conversion for .NET beállítására.

A GroupDocs.Conversion beállítása .NET-hez

Használat GroupDocs.Conversion a projektedben NuGet-en keresztül kell telepítened. Így csináld:

A NuGet csomagkezelő konzol használata:

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ET parancssori felület használata:

dotnet add package GroupDocs.Conversion --version 25.3.0

Licencbeszerzés lépései

A GroupDocs.Conversion funkcióinak teljes kihasználásához ingyenes próbaverzióval kezdheti, vagy ideiglenes licencet kérhet kiértékelési célokra. Hosszú távú használathoz licenc vásárlása ajánlott.

  1. Ingyenes próbaverzióTöltsd le és teszteld az alapvető funkciókat korlátozások nélkül.
  2. Ideiglenes engedély: Kérje ezt a GroupDocs weboldal a haladó funkciók felfedezéséhez.
  3. VásárlásA megszakítás nélküli hozzáféréshez vásároljon teljes licencet a következő címen: ezt a linket.

Alapvető inicializálás és beállítás

Így inicializálhatod a GroupDocs.Conversion függvényt a C# alkalmazásodban:

using System;
using GroupDocs.Conversion;

class Program
{
    static void Main(string[] args)
    {
        // Inicializálja a konverziókezelőt
        var converter = new Converter("YOUR_DOCUMENT_DIRECTORY/sample.ods");
        
        // Ide fog kerülni a konverziós logika
    }
}

Miután beállította a környezetét, folytassa az ODS HTML-re konvertáló funkció megvalósításával.

Megvalósítási útmutató

Ebben a szakaszban lebontjuk az ODS-fájl HTML-lé konvertálásának folyamatát a GroupDocs.Conversion for .NET használatával.

1. lépés: Készítse elő a környezetét

Kezd azzal, hogy ellenőrizd, hogy a bemeneti és kimeneti könyvtárak megfelelően vannak-e beállítva a projektedben. Használj relatív elérési utakat vagy környezeti változókat szükség szerint:

string inputFilePath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.ods");
string outputFolder = "YOUR_OUTPUT_DIRECTORY";

2. lépés: A kimeneti könyvtár létrehozása

Konvertálás előtt győződjön meg arról, hogy a kimeneti könyvtár létezik a futásidejű hibák elkerülése érdekében:

if (!Directory.Exists(outputFolder))
{
    Directory.CreateDirectory(outputFolder);
}

3. lépés: Végezze el az átalakítást

Töltsd be az ODS fájlt, és konvertáld HTML-be a GroupDocs.Conversion segítségével. Így csináld:

string outputFile = Path.Combine(outputFolder, "ods-converted-to.html");

using (var converter = new Converter(inputFilePath))
{
    var options = new WebConvertOptions(); // Konvertálási beállítások beállítása webes formátumokhoz, például HTML-hez
    converter.Convert(outputFile, options);  // Hajtsa végre a konverziót, és mentse el az eredményt
}

Főbb paraméterek magyarázata:

  • bemeneti fájlútvonal: A forrás ODS-fájl elérési útja.
  • kimeneti fájl: A HTML-fájl mentési útvonala.
  • WebConvertOptions: Webes formátumokhoz igazított konverziós beállításokat konfigurál.

Hibaelhárítási tippek

  • Győződjön meg arról, hogy a GroupDocs.Conversion könyvtárra helyesen van hivatkozva a projektben.
  • Ellenőrizze, hogy az elérési utak helyesek és elérhetők-e az alkalmazás számára.

Ezekkel a lépésekkel működő ODS-HTML konverterrel kell rendelkezned. Ezután vizsgáljuk meg a konvertálási folyamat néhány gyakorlati alkalmazását.

Gyakorlati alkalmazások

Az ODS-fájlok HTML-be konvertálásának lehetősége számos valós felhasználási esetet nyit meg:

  1. Adatmegjelenítés: Táblázatok weboldalakká alakítása a jobb adatvizualizáció és -megosztás érdekében.
  2. WebintegrációTáblázatadatok beágyazása közvetlenül webhelyekre vagy intranetekre manuális formázás nélkül.
  3. Automatizált jelentéskészítésAutomatikusan generáljon jelentéseket webbarát formátumban, javítva az akadálymentességet.

más .NET rendszerekkel való integráció zökkenőmentes, lehetővé téve a funkciók további bővítését az alkalmazásain belül.

Teljesítménybeli szempontok

Az optimális teljesítmény érdekében a konverzió során:

  • Az erőforrások kezelése a tárgyak használat utáni megfelelő megsemmisítésével.
  • Használjon aszinkron programozási modelleket, ahol lehetséges, a válaszidő javítása érdekében.
  • Figyelemmel kíséri a memóriahasználatot, és optimalizálja a kódot a nagy fájlok hatékony kezelése érdekében.

A .NET memóriakezelés legjobb gyakorlatainak követése zökkenőmentes és hatékony konvertálási folyamatot biztosít a GroupDocs.Conversion segítségével.

Következtetés

Most már megtanultad, hogyan konvertálhatsz ODS fájlokat HTML-be a következő segítségével: GroupDocs.Conversion .NET-hezEz a hatékony eszköz leegyszerűsíti a táblázatadatok webbarát formátumba alakítását, javítva az akadálymentességet és a megjelenítést. További információkért érdemes lehet integrálni ezt a funkciót nagyobb alkalmazásokba, vagy felfedezni a GroupDocs által kínált további konverziós lehetőségeket.

Következő lépések:

  • Kísérletezzen különböző konverziós beállításokkal
  • Fedezze fel a GroupDocs.Conversion által támogatott egyéb fájlformátumokat

Készen állsz kipróbálni? Kezdd el alkalmazni ezeket a technikákat a projektjeidben még ma!

GYIK szekció

1. kérdés: Milyen rendszerkövetelmények szükségesek a GroupDocs.Conversion használatához?

  1. válasz: Szüksége van a .NET Frameworkre vagy a .NET Core-ra, valamint a Visual Studio egy kompatibilis verziójára.

2. kérdés: Hatékonyan konvertálhatok nagy ODS fájlokat? A2: Igen, megfelelő memóriakezelési gyakorlatokkal hatékonyan kezelheti a nagy fájlokat.

3. kérdés: Hogyan javíthatom ki a konverziós hibákat? 3. válasz: Ellenőrizze a fájlelérési utakat, győződjön meg arról, hogy a könyvtárra megfelelően hivatkozik, és útmutatásért tekintse át a hibaüzeneteket.

4. kérdés: Van-e korlátozás arra vonatkozóan, hogy egy ODS fájlban hány oldal konvertálható? 4. válasz: Nincsenek konkrét korlátok, de a teljesítmény a rendszer erőforrásaitól függően változhat.

5. kérdés: Konvertálhatok más táblázatformátumokat a GroupDocs.Conversion segítségével? V5: Igen, különféle formátumokat támogat, beleértve az XLSX-et, a CSV-t és egyebeket. Ellenőrizze a API-referencia a részletekért.

Erőforrás

További segítségért csatlakozzon a GroupDocs támogatási fórumJó kódolást!